Radio Ministry – "The Hour of Light"

Program Relaunch
We have been receiving a lot of positive feedback on the relaunched Radio Ministry of the church. The Radio Broadcast “The Hour of Light” is aired every Tuesday 7-8pm on Manna 96.1FM. The program was off air for several months while undergoing changes (more like surgery:-). Finally, we were back on air Tuesday October 3, 2006.

Ministry Opportunity
I have not missed the fact that here we have an excellent radio ministry opportunity with the program being available on the web. This was what we had in mind to eventually do when we have completed setting up our website. So we are thankful to God, that already we are reaching Panamanian Christians who are now abroad, and especially members of First Isthmian who no longer live in Panama.

These members are able to send live greetings to relatives, friends and members of the church they have not been in contact with for years. They are also able to maintain a live link with their home church.

The program is bi-lingual and the English speaking persons in Colon City and its environs find this to be a tremendous blessing. Moreover, many persons use this as a means of learning English.
